Marlow Planning Board - December 14, 2004 / Unapproved minutes of meeting  

Present: Joseph Feuer, Trish Rogan, Deb Monte, Bonnie Hazelton, and Ray Despres    

Absent: Carl McConnell and Deborah Washburn

The meeting was called to order at 7:10. The minutes from November 9, 2004 were read and unanimously approved as typed.

Old Business

Mr. Feuer reported that at the November 23rd meeting of the Marlow ZBA, John and Martha Walsh’s application for an equitable waiver of dimensional requirements was denied by the Marlow Zoning Board of Adjustment.

Deb Monte reported on the status of a cellular tower to be placed on Marlow Hill - the next step would be to bring it before the town meeting in March.

Liz Davis, Jen Brown, Rhondi Mahoney and Dave Vesco were all present to discuss some revisions they’d made to the drafts of proposed Articles designed to improve animal control and animal care in Marlow. It was determined that a public hearing should be held (on January 11, 2005) in regard to the articles related directly to Marlow’s Zoning Ordinance and Building Regulations. The citizens’ group would present their article(s) directly to the Marlow Selectmen to be included in the town’s warrant.

New Business

Travis Royce of Landmark Land Services was present to discuss plans for a property line adjustment on two pieces of property presently owned by Gil Bailey. The lots are located on Rte 10 and identified as Lot 28-002 and 28-003, from Map 412. Mr. Bailey wishes to adjust the lot line, increasing Lot 28-002 from 23 acres to 27.1 acres, and decreasing Lot 28-003 from 25.1 acres to 21 acres. Mr. Bailey’s home is on Lot 28-002. The Planning Board reviewed the maps and discussion followed on the status of these properties in regard to Current Use. Since the proposed property line adjustment doesn’t involve creation of a new lot, or affect any abutting properties, there is no need for a public hearing. The Board determined there was no problem with the plan, and requested that Mr. Royce bring the mylar and copies of the revised map to the next regular meeting of the Planning Board.

The meeting was adjourned at 8:55 p.m.

The next regular meeting of the Marlow Planning Board will be on Tuesday, January 11, 2005, immediately following the public hearing scheduled for 7:00 p.m.
